Description
As with many inventions, the incandescent electric bulb was not Edison's alone. His genius was to envision networks of lighting. This simple invention literally lit up the world. Gas lighting was smelly, dim, and messy. It ruined fabrics and interiors. And, was dangerous. Unfortunately incandescent bulbs use 95% of its power to give off 5% of its light. LEDS now mimic the warmth of the old ones and use a tenth the power.
And, they last over 20 years. So farewell old friend. You served us well.
